Governor's Academy senior Mackenzie Gray of Andover went 40-0 then 40-0.75 to place fifth in the triple jump at New Balance Nationals. No other local girl has gone that far. The previous mark was 40-0 by Camille Quarles of Pinkerton in 2007.

Read More »Yorgelis Ortiz won two individual events, the 55 meter dash (7.2) and the long jump (17-5.50), at the Division 1 state meet.
Meanwhile, Britney Johnson of Pinkerton won the 1,000 (3:10.23) and teammate Morgan Sansing won the 3,000 (10:13) to lead the Astros to a third-place team finish with 46 points.
